Each build artifact includes the compiler version, the dependency lockfile digest, and the CI runner fingerprint. Plugins targeting the dedupe API should pin against a verified release rather than a nightly, since nightlies may change the suppression-window semantics without notice. Verification tooling ships with the SDK and checks signatures offline. The current verified release corresponds to the trace token shown below.

build token for kagaf-hahof: htk14_9d3d4d26d7d8de

Sales leads: starting Q3, Tier 1 customer support for the Brayline product family will transition to Corvan Desk Services, operating out of their Mellowford center. In-house staff will focus on Tier 2 escalations and enterprise accounts. Expect a four-week overlap period; ticket routing changes go live mid-quarter. Please flag any strategic accounts that should remain on the in-house queue by end of month. Handoff scripts and escalation matrices are being drafted now. The rationale for this move is outlined below.

internal memo for kawip-hadug: Headcount on the Wenwyn team goes from 7 to 140 by the end of January. Gross margin on Wenwyn came in at 20 percent against a plan of 15 percent.

## Deployment

The Tallyforge ledger records loyalty-point accruals and redemptions for all storefronts on the Bramblewick platform. Plugin authors deploying against a local instance should run the ledger in sandbox mode, which disables settlement hooks and uses an in-memory journal. Plugins communicate with the ledger exclusively through the gateway; direct journal access is not supported and will be rejected. To start a sandbox instance, supply the following configuration values:

config for bahop-fajep:
DRUATH_PIN=4501
DRUATH_TENANT=briwyn
DRUATH_METRICS_HOST=metrics.druath.brasksoft.test
DRUATH_SEAL=seal_7d2e069d
DRUATH_STANDBY_TEAM=olieth